What Exactly Is Fusion Welding for PPR?

Fusion welding is the OG method. You grab your heating tool, crank it up to 260°C, shove the PPR pipe and fitting together, hold for a few seconds, and boom — they become one solid piece of plastic. No gaskets, no O-rings, no moving parts. Just molten plastic that cools down and fuses permanently.

The downside? You need a fusion machine. You need skill. You need to wait for it to cool. And if you mess up the temperature or the timing, you get a weak joint that leaks later. Nobody wants that.

So What Is Push Fit Then?

Push fit is the newer kid on the block. You literally push the pipe into the fitting and hear a satisfying click. That is it. No heat, no flame, no waiting. The fitting has an internal grip ring — usually EPDM or silicone — that bites into the pipe and holds it tight.

The big win here is speed. A push fit joint takes about 5 seconds. A fusion joint takes 30 to 60 seconds plus cooling time. On a big job with hundreds of connections? That adds up fast.

Head-to-Head: Push Fit vs Fusion Welding

FactorFusion WeldingPush Fit
SpeedSlower — needs heating and coolingSuper fast — just push and done
Skill LevelNeeds training and practiceAlmost anyone can do it
Leak RiskVery low if done rightLow, but grip rings can fail over decades
DisassemblyImpossible — it is permanentEasy — just pull it apart
Temperature RatingUp to 95°C continuousUp to 95°C, but check grip ring specs
Best ForPermanent hidden installationsAccessible areas, rental properties, quick repairs
